Joe Collier of Clyde went for the track competition record and lowered the bar considerably from the old 4.42 mark set in 1993.  The new mark is now 3.94 @ 181.09.  Joe made the pass running in Open Trophy.  Joe didn't win a trophy and tossed out some parts on the second try to lower the mark even more.  We'll bet he'll try to set the record again pretty soon. 
Thanks to the Rocky Mountain Thunder Jet Funny and the Invader Jet Dragster. Invader is going to take away Ansel Horton's jet record one of these days.  The 3.87 @ 210 is only .24 and 2 MPH off

Sunday Morning Eliminators

Southwest Superchargers: The Southwest Superchargers brought 17 cars to the race.  Old style slingshot dragsters, Altereds, a couple of door cars - all loud, all fast.  The superchargers run against a 4.70 index, but are free to wing it out should the round allow. The eventual runner up Jake Penner from Seminole let his riar motor dragster fly to a 4.53 in the second round when then opponent Julian Moody red lit.  After Jake and event winner Ray Stringer worked through a 16 car field, the race was decided on the starting line by the "first or worst" rule.  Ray (top) takes the win with a -.0217 red light and a 4.78 @ 144.05.  Jake runner's up only because he left quicker with a -.0354 red light.  He clocked a faster 4.63 @ 148.17.  This is Penner's second runner up at Abilene.  The Supercharger's third visit will be at the Abilene Shooout, maybe 3's a charm for Jake?

A.J. Enterprises Top ET: Kevin Bracey (top) topped off the long race night with a .001 light and a 4.85 on a 4.80 dial to grab the win in Top.  Jeb Edwards came all the way from Labe, Oklahoma and took home runner up honors, running 5.28 on a 5.26 with a .052 reaction time.
Audio Magic Modified ET: Modified stuck it out to the end and in the final it was Robert Hector taking home the winner's sticker and cash.  Linda Lamb from Lubbock went -005 red and that was that.  Red's no good, but to still be that quick at 5:30AM is quite a feat.  It would have been a close race - Robert hit a .026 light and ran 8.733 on a 8.70 dial with Linda running 5.837 on a 5.80.
 
Longmire Plumbing Jr. Dragster: Dustin Douglas of Abilene (top) must have come into his "second wind" in the wee hours.  Dustin "hot shoe" had the best light of the finals, hitting the tree with a .0006 light and running 8.03 on a 7.98 for the win.  Heather Swiney was going for it too, but was a little too quick and went -.141 red to give the win to Dustin. This would have been another close one because even with Dustin's killer light, Heather still ran almost dead one with a 8.209 on an 8.21 dial. 
Max's Kawasaki Motorcycle: John Poor of Max's Kawasaki in Abilene (top) went dead on 6.012 on a 6.01 for the win in Motorcycle.  Stacy Calder of Abilene runnered up on a break outt pass, clocking 6.36 under a 6.40 dial.

Dodge Rambunctious Friday Night Gamblers

Dodge Rambunction Friday Top ET All Run Quick: Joseph Tinsley (top) of Melvin get's another win on Friday, but this one had a mondo payday attached to it.  Joseph used a .005 light and a 4.963 on a 4.95 to win $3850 in the Top All Run Quick.   Runner up Preston Pennington from Three Rivers had a great .015 light and ran a dead on 5.308 on a 5.30, but had to settle for only $1650 left in the pot.   It was one of those nights where dead on with an X and a great light just might not be good enough!  60 cars participated, running for a $5500 total pot. 
Dodge Rambunction Friday Modified All Run Quick: Modified saw the cash and with 6 people left they split up the pot.  $518 each is a nice Friday take home.  Maybe wishing they'd held out longer were winner Sambo Tyra (top) and Runner up Theresa Dempsey.  Sambo got the winner's sticker with a 7.08 on a 7.05 run with Theresa comming in second on a break out 8.812 under an 8.82.
